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face
- Poor Airflow
Limited air flow makes your system work harder and lowers comfort. Our HVAC specialists identify airflow issues, whether triggered by duct issues, filthy filters, or fan issues.
- Uneven Heating or Cooling
If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ct issues, insulation issues, or an incorrectly sized system. Our expert HVAC specialists can detect these issues and recommend solutions.
- Brief Cycling
When your system turns on and off frequently, it loses energy and breaks components much faster. Our HVAC specialists can figure out whether the issue stems from a clogged up fil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more major.
- High Energy Bills
Unexpected increases in energy expenses often indicate HVAC inadequacy. Our professionals carry out energy effectiveness evaluations to determine the cause and recommend improvements.
- Humidity Problems
Modern HVAC systems ought to help man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er season or too dry in winter, our HVAC specialists can recommend services to enhance convenience and air quality.
- Thermostat Problems
In some cases what appears like a system failure is really a thermostat issue. Our HVAC contractors can repair or replace th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or smart models for much better comfort control and energy cost savings.

Getting Ready For HVAC Emergencies
- Keep Contact Information Handy
Shop our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us rapidly when needed.
- Know Your System Basics
Familiarize yourself with the location of your HVAC equipment and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
- Perform Regular Maintenance
Routine expert upkeep lowers the likelihood of emergencies. Our HVAC specialists can establish a maintenance schedule for your system.
- Set Up Carbon Monoxide Detectors
If you have combustion heating devices, carbon monoxide gas detectors offer an early warning of unsafe leaks.
